Geelong could be without Patrick Dangerfield for Friday night’s Opening Round clash with Gold Coast.
The veteran skipper, who wasn’t on the club’s official injury list that was released this (Tuesday) afternoon, says he’s battling a calf knock sustained last month.
“I’ve got to get through a session Thursday morning,” Dangerfield told Fox Footy.
“I just couldn’t get to the speed that I wanted to today.
“I had a calf knock a couple of weeks ago and just couldn’t get to speed against Carlton, and the same thing today.
“Getting above a certain km/h is obviously a critical part of preparing, and we won’t take a risk that’s unnecessary, regardless of whether it’s Round 1.
“You’d rather miss one than miss four.”
Earlier in the day, Geelong coach Chris Scott told his first media conference of the season that Bailey Smith, Jeremy Cameron and Shannon Neale would take on the Suns, while there was some doubt over Gryan Miers.
